This Khilwah speaks of longing not as despair, but as sacred fire — a reminder that the soul is alive and still reaching for the Source. Longing itself is a form of worship.
Khilwah 02: The Longing Flame
- Between silence and breath, there is a fire that does not consume.
- It burns not to destroy, but to remind.
- I felt it when absence widened, when no word could reach.
- Longing is not weakness; it is the proof that Love still lives.
- Every tear is a verse; every sigh, a witness.
- The Flame does not fade — it waits, patient, in the hollow of the chest.
- In longing, I find You closer than nearness itself.
Zephyr: Why does it hurt so much — this longing?
Zephyrina: Because it is the fire that teaches you: what burns is not lost. What burns is returning.
